How to Improve Your Nail Health : The Quick Way?

Nail is a horny structure that grows as an outer enclosure of the finger edges. Gone are those days where nails are kept cut and trimmed all the time. To sport long nails is a symbol of beauty and needless to say, today’s women consider it as a style quotient.

How to treat allergies?

At times, the human body reacts to small traces of foreign substances that might actually be harmless. Although harmless, these reactions could be irritating at times.
